Eucalyptus crispata (Eucalyptus crispata)
Description
Eucalyptus crispata,commonly known as the Yandanooka mallee,is a mallee that is native to Western Australia.The mallee typically grows to a height of 3 to 7 metres (10 to 23 ft) and has rough bark on the tree trunk.It blooms between March and June producing yellow-cream flowers.It is found among lateritic breakaways in the western Wheatbelt region of Western Australia between Dandaragan,Carnamah and Three Springs where it grows in gravelly sandy-loam soils.
